Three situations where intent shifts
- Market cycles change queries Bull runs spike searches for 'buy' and 'price prediction'; bear markets for 'how to store' and 'tax rules'. Unlike b2b seo solutions, crypto keyword sets change with market cycles.
- Regulatory news creates urgency New laws trigger searches like 'is crypto legal' or tax rules. Old content on those topics can become outdated quickly.
- New products change competition A new exchange or token launch floods SERPs with fresh intent. Decide quickly whether to create a new page or update an existing hub.
Three mistakes that cost you rankings
- One page for everything A single page covering all crypto services confuses search engines. Dedicated pages for each coin improve relevance and click-through rates.
- Keyword-stuffed titles and headers Google's title link guidance warns against over-optimised titles. Use natural phrasing with the target term, e.g., 'Buy Bitcoin: A Beginner's Guide' — similar to seo for b2b companies, but faster.
- Weak technical foundations Slow page speed, poor mobile usability, or crawl barriers can keep great content from ranking. Start with a technical audit to confirm accessibility and speed.
Common questions
What are the best keywords for cryptocurrency?
The best keywords match user intent: high-volume for awareness, specific long-tail for targeted queries. Avoid broad terms like 'crypto'.
Is SEO for crypto different from general SEO?
Yes. Crypto is YMYL, so trust signals and authoritative sourcing matter more. Search intent shifts rapidly with market conditions, requiring agile content updates.
How do I find crypto SEO keywords?
Use keyword research tools for commercial intent terms like 'buy Bitcoin' or 'best crypto wallet'. Also monitor trending topics around new coins or regulations.
